Deal proactively with rights violations

Rights violations in the workplace are serious and should be handled immediately. Here鈥檚 what you can do:

  • Start with Your Supervisor: Address the issue directly with your supervisor to seek resolution.
  • Escalate to HR: If unresolved, escalate the issue to Human Resources for further action.
  • Speak with Your Course Coordinator: For course-related jobs, talk to your practicum or internship coordinator for support.
  • Union Support: If you鈥檙e in a union, contact your union representative for guidance through the grievance process.
  • Consult an Employment Lawyer: For serious violations or if the issue persists, consider seeking legal advice.
  • Government Assistance: File an Employment Standards Claim with the Ontario Ministry of Labour for issues like unpaid wages or overtime.
  • Human Rights Complaints: For human rights violations, consider filing a complaint with the Ontario Human Rights Tribunal.
